Why you need to conduct a meth test

Methamphetamine — meth, ice, crystal meth — has a rapidly increasing presence in Australia. Even a single use or small-scale production can contaminate a property, and the risks aren't obvious.

  • Resilient Residue — contamination can linger on surfaces for extended periods.
  • Invisible Threat — odourless and invisible; you can't rely on your senses to detect it.
  • Health Risks — respiratory issues, skin irritation and long-term neurological damage.
  • Property Devaluation — a contaminated property can be difficult to sell or rent.
  • Legal Implications — failing to test can create legal complications if occupants are later affected.
  • Hidden Manufacturing — labs can be concealed in unsuspecting homes and rental properties.

Our method

How we test for meth

We use advanced presumptive screening tests (per Section 6.5 of the Australian Voluntary Code of Practice, 2019) that deliver fast, reliable initial results. We sample up to 10 high-risk areas identified through training and industry knowledge, including:

  • Areas of high air flow — range hoods, fans, doorways and windows.
  • Locations high up in rooms, and areas with electrical currents.
  • Locations less likely to have been cleaned, or with visible staining.

A positive result indicates contamination above the investigation level and triggers a detailed assessment. A negative result indicates methamphetamine isn't present at or above that level. Either way, you'll receive a full report with photos and recommendations.
